Power supply Your computer comes with a 120-watt automatic voltage-sensing power supply. Security features • Computrace Agent software embedded in firmware • Ability to enable or disable a device • Ability to enable and disable USB connectors individually • Power-on password (POP), administrator password, and hard disk drive password to deter unauthorized use of your computer • Startup sequence control • Startup without keyboard or mouse • Support for an integrated cable lock (Kensington lock) For more information, see Chapter 4 "Security" on page 23. Preinstalled software programs Your computer is preinstalled with software programs to help you work more easily and securely. For more information, see "Lenovo programs" on page 4. Preinstalled operating system Your computer is preinstalled with one of the following operating systems: • Microsoft Windows 7 operating system • Microsoft Windows 8 operating system Operating system(s), certified or tested for compatibility1 (varies by model type) • Linux® • Microsoft Windows XP Professional SP 3 1. The operating system(s) listed here are being certified or tested for compatibility at the time this publication goes to press. Additional operating systems might be identified by Lenovo as compatible with your computer following the publication of this manual. This list is subject to change. To determine if an operating system has been certified or tested for compatibility, check the Web site of the operating system vendor. Chapter 1. Product overview 3
